Groundwater development is the process of extracting and using groundwater from aquifers for various purposes. It is a major source of water for agricultural, industrial, and domestic use. Groundwater development is often used to supplement surface water sources, such as rivers and lakes, when they are not available or are insufficient. Groundwater development can also be used to reduce the impacts of drought and climate change. Groundwater development involves the construction of wells, pumps, and other infrastructure to access and manage the groundwater. It also includes the monitoring and management of groundwater resources to ensure that they are used sustainably. This includes the implementation of regulations and policies to protect groundwater resources from over-exploitation and pollution. Groundwater development is a major industry, with many companies providing services such as well drilling, pump installation, and water management.
